The Orioles today announced an all-new social space, built around the existing flags in right field where fans can enjoy Orioles baseball.
In partnership with Corona, the club has begun construction of a new bar on the Flag Court, set to be open following the All-Star break. Open-to-the-public, the redesigned space will feature an open-air, wraparound bar to one of the ballpark’s most popular gathering spots. With service from both the Flag Court and Eutaw Street sides, fans will soon be able to enjoy a refreshing beverage while enjoying great views of the action on the field.
